In today’s Nigerian newspapers review programme, Today in the News, Vanguard leads with reports on FCT Minister Nyesom Wike criticising Governor Seyi Makinde over claims that Wike pledged to “hold” the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) for President Bola Tinubu.

Another headline states that British-Nigerian boxer Anthony Joshua narrowly survived a fatal road accident near the Sinoma/Makun axis, Sagamu, on the Lagos–Ibadan Expressway, but two of his team members were killed.

Vanguard also reports that Peter Obi said he is better prepared to address Nigeria’s economic and security challenges if given the opportunity.

Moving to another newspaper, The Guardian reports that Nigeria’s power grid suffered another collapse as electricity generation fell to 231.50MW, causing widespread blackouts and cutting supply to most distributing companies.

Next paper, The Punch leads with the military tracking Boko Haram and ISWAP fighters as they flee their hideouts after the recent US airstrikes.

Finally, The Nation reports that the Presidential Fiscal Policy and Tax Reforms Committee has dismissed claims that the new tax laws will sharply increase airfares.
